Docker is a lightweight, portable tool that can free you from having to install server software on your local machine. The containers Docker creates can be started and stopped on any computer, easing deployment and configuration.
In this course, Envato Tuts+ instructor Reggie Dawson will teach you how to use Docker to create and manage portable web development environments. You'll learn how to modify images for your own use and share them on the Docker hub and how to use Kitematic, the GUI interface for Docker. Finally, you'll see how to create some practical web server instances for NGINX and WordPress, and how to set up a portable development environment using Codebox.
1.Introduction1 lesson, 00:43
1 lesson, 00:43
1.1Introduction00:43
1.1
Introduction
00:43
2.Starting With Docker6 lessons, 29:40
6 lessons, 29:40
2.1What Is Docker?03:24
2.1
What Is Docker?
03:24
2.2Install Docker04:27
2.2
Install Docker
04:27
2.3Find and Run Images07:32
2.3
Find and Run Images
07:32
2.4Kitematic Docker GUI04:04
2.4
Kitematic Docker GUI
04:04
2.5Manage Containers and Images06:40
2.5
Manage Containers and Images
06:40
2.6Container Networking03:33
2.6
Container Networking
03:33
3.Web Servers With Docker3 lessons, 14:26
3 lessons, 14:26
3.1Installing httpd and NGINX04:05
3.1
Installing httpd and NGINX
04:05
3.2Installing Ghost and WordPress05:07
3.2
Installing Ghost and WordPress
05:07
3.3Installing Codebox With Ionic05:14
3.3
Installing Codebox With Ionic
05:14
4.Conclusion1 lesson, 00:44
1 lesson, 00:44
4.1Conclusion00:44
4.1
Conclusion
00:44
I'm a longtime Network admin who has finally moved over to coding. Skilled in web development and obsessed with frameworks (Angular, Meteor and Ionic to name a few), I am using my past experience as an instructor to help others learn to use technology.